Home / Glossary / Software Inventory Management
March 19, 2024

Software Inventory Management

March 19, 2024
Read 2 min

Software Inventory Management refers to the process of tracking and managing software assets within an organization. It involves maintaining an up-to-date record of all software licenses, installations, and usage across different systems and departments. This systematic approach allows businesses to optimize the use of their software resources, ensure compliance with licensing agreements, and manage costs effectively.

Overview:

In today’s technology-driven world, software plays a crucial role in the day-to-day operations of organizations. As businesses grow and evolve, the number of software applications and licenses they acquire also increases. Without proper management, this can lead to inefficiencies, overspending, and compliance issues.

Software Inventory Management provides a centralized view of the software assets owned or used by an organization. It involves creating a comprehensive inventory of software licenses, versions, installations, and usage across various workstations and servers. This inventory acts as a reference point for managing software assets effectively.

Advantages:

Effective Software Inventory Management offers several benefits to organizations:

  1. Cost Optimization: By keeping track of software licenses and usage, businesses can identify unused or underutilized licenses. This allows them to make informed decisions about renewing licenses, reassigning licenses to other users, or eliminating unnecessary costs.
  2. Compliance and Audit Readiness: Maintaining accurate records of software licenses ensures compliance with licensing agreements and reduces the risk of costly penalties during software audits. Software Inventory Management helps organizations demonstrate that their use of software aligns with licensing terms and conditions.
  3. Improved Efficiency: With a centralized software inventory, IT teams can easily identify software versions, updates, and patches. Timely deployment of updates and patches helps enhance system performance, security, and stability, ensuring smooth business operations.
  4. Risk Mitigation: By identifying and tracking software vulnerabilities and known security risks, organizations can proactively address potential threats. Software Inventory Management enables businesses to stay informed about the latest security updates and ensure their systems are protected.

Applications:

Software Inventory Management finds applications in various areas within an organization:

  1. License Compliance: IT departments and software asset managers can use software inventory data to ensure compliance with software licensing agreements. By reconciling installed software against purchased licenses, they can identify any non-compliance issues and take corrective actions.
  2. Cost Control: Finance teams can leverage software inventory reports to optimize software spending. By identifying redundant licenses or negotiating better licensing agreements based on actual usage, organizations can control costs and improve overall budget management.
  3. Change Management: Software Inventory Management plays a crucial role during system upgrades and migrations. By understanding the current software landscape, IT teams can plan migration strategies effectively, ensuring a smooth transition with minimal disruption.

Conclusion:

Software Inventory Management is a critical practice for organizations of all sizes. It enables businesses to effectively manage their software assets, optimize costs, ensure compliance, and mitigate risks. By maintaining accurate records of software licenses, installations, and usage, businesses can streamline their IT operations, improve resource allocation, and enhance overall productivity. Taking a systematic approach to software inventory management is essential for efficient software asset management and the overall success of an organization’s IT infrastructure.

Recent Articles

Visit Blog

How cloud call centers help Financial Firms?

Revolutionizing Fintech: Unleashing Success Through Seamless UX/UI Design

Trading Systems: Exploring the Differences

Back to top